Scrubfield runbook: all uploads pass through the EXIF scrubbing worker before reaching the public CDN. The worker strips GPS, serial, and thumbnail blocks but preserves orientation tags — removing those broke gallery rendering last quarter. If the scrub queue backs up, scale workers rather than skipping the stage. The worker fetches its strip-policy bundle from the Lanthorn config service, authenticating with the credential set on the following line.

secret setting of yajog-taguf: ARCHIVE_KEY3=051

14:22 — On-call engineer Mira Holt confirmed the Pelloway tile cache was serving stale zoom-level-12 tiles after the eviction sweep stalled. For new team members: this is the classic symptom of a wedged sweep thread, not corrupt tiles. She restarted the sweep workers and captured diagnostics. The trace token from that capture appears below.

pipeline stamp: htk9_ce63042d9

## Break-Glass Access: Telemetry Compression Service

Future maintainers: the Brindlework compressor batches telemetry payloads, applies dictionary-trained compression per stream, and ships frames to cold storage. Under normal operation no human touches the dictionary store. Break-glass access exists solely for when a corrupted dictionary makes payloads undecodable fleet-wide. Invoking it disables compression, alerts the platform owners, and records a full audit trail. The emergency console accepts only the recovery passphrase printed below.

vault phrase of bagaf-kajeg = jorath-feniel-briir-siliel-ralix